【基于JavaScript获取鼠标位置的各种方法】教程文章相关的互联网学习教程文章

Javascript获取CSS伪元素属性的实现代码_javascript技巧

CSS伪元素非常强大,它经常被用来创建CSS三角形提示,使用CSS伪元素可以实现一些简单的效果但又不需要增加额外的HTML标签。有一点就是Javascript无法获取到这些CSS属性值,但现在有一种方法可以获取到: 看看下面的CSS代码:.element:before {content: NEW;color: rgb(255, 0, 0); }.element:before {content: NEW;color: rgb(255, 0, 0); }为了获取到.element:before的颜色属性,你可以使用下面的代码:var color = window.getCom...

利用原生JavaScript获取元素样式只是获取而已_javascript技巧【图】

ps:是获取样式,不是设置样式。若没有给元素设置样式值,则返回浏览器给予的默认值。(论坛整理) 1、element.style:只能获取写在元素标签中的style属性里的样式值,无法获取到定义在和通过加载进来的样式属性代码如下: var ele = document.getElementById(ele); ele.style.color; //获取颜色2、window.getComputedStyle():可以获取当前元素所有最终使用的CSS属性值。代码如下: window.getComputedStyle("元素", "伪类");这个方法...

Javascript获取当前时间函数和时间操作小结_javascript技巧【图】

在项目需要一个计时器,效果如下:js代码:代码如下:/*获取当前时间*/function getCurrentDate(){var timeStr = ;var curDate = new Date();var curMonth = curDate.getMonth()+1; //获取当前月份(0-11,0代表1月)var curDay = curDate.getDate(); //获取当前日(1-31)var curWeekDay = curDate.getDay(); //获取当前星期X(0-6,0代表星期天)var curHour = curDate.getHours(); //获取当前小时数(0-23)var curMinute =...

Javascript获取当前日期的农历日期代码【图】

这篇文章主要介绍了利用Javascript获取当前日期的农历日期代码,很实用,需要的朋友可以参考下。JavaScript代码/*设置农历日期*/ var CalendarData=new Array(100); var madd=new Array(12); var numString="一二三四五六七八九十"; var monString="正二三四五六七八九十冬腊"; var cYear,cMonth,cDay,TheDate;// 农历每月只能是29或30天,一年用12(或13)个二进制位表示,从高到低,对应位为1表示30天,否则29天 CalendarData = ne...

一个JavaScript获取元素当前高度的实例_javascript技巧

每天一个JavaScript实例-获取元素当前高度 #date{width:90%;height:25%;padding:10px;background: red;} window.onload = function(){ var height = getHeight(); console.log(height); } function getHeight(){ var height = 0; var div = document.getElementById("date").getBoundingClientRect(); if(div.height){ height = div.height; }else{ height = div.bottom - div.top; } return height; }

javascript获取flash版本号的方法

这篇文章主要介绍了javascript获取flash版本号的方法,以实例形式分析了javascript判断用户是否安装了Flash及获取Flash版本号的方法,具有一定的实用价值,需要的朋友可以参考下,具体分析如下:下面我们来介绍两个js函数判断用户是否安装了flash,如果安装了flash再来获取 flash版本号并且给出提示。例1:获取各浏览器的版本号,如需获取具体版本号数字function flashChecker() {var hasFlash = 0; //是否安装了flashvar flashVer...

JavaScript获取网页、浏览器、屏幕高度和宽度汇总_javascript技巧

经常发现在写JavaScript的时候,都需要用到网页、浏览器或屏幕的高度和宽度来解决布局定位的问题,时常前用后忘,要不就是在网上search,干脆自己总结一下,这样也方便再次使用,省时省力。 网页可见区域宽:document.body.clientWidth 网页可见区域高:document.body.clientHeight 网页可见区域宽:document.body.offsetWidth (包括边线的宽) 网页可见区域高:document.body.offsetHeight (包括边线的宽) 网页正文全文宽:doc...

JavaScript获取Url里的参数_javascript技巧【图】

最近开发的项目需要用JavaScript读取Url字符串里的参数的值 通过查找资料和自己的试验,总算成功 脚本如下:代码如下: function GetRequest(strName){var strHref = window.location.href; //获取Url字串var intPos = strHref.indexOf(""); // 参数开始位置var strRight = strHref.substr(intPos + 1);var arrTmp = strRight.split("&"); //参数分割符for(var i = 0; i { var arrTemp = arrTmp[i].split("="); if(arrTemp[0].toUp...

使用JavaScript获取地址栏参数的方法_javascript技巧

代码如下: /*** 获取地址栏参数** @example GetUrlString(id)** @desc 调用时加上判断,保证程序不会出错* var myurl = GetUrlString(id);* if (myurl != null && myurl.toString().length > 1) {* alert(GetUrlString("id")); * }** @param String param 要获取地址栏中的参数名* @return String Value* @type String** @name GetUrlString()**/ function GetUrlStri...

使用javascript获取页面名称_javascript技巧

代码很简单,就不多废话了,奉上代码:代码如下: // 取当前页面名称(不带后缀名) function getPageName1() {var a = location.href;var b = a.split("/");var c = b.slice(b.length-1, b.length).toString().split(".");return c.slice(0, 1); }//取当前页面名称(带后缀名) function getPageName2(){var strUrl=location.href;var arrUrl=strUrl.split("/");var strPage=arrUrl[arrUrl.length-1];return strPage;}

原生javascript获取元素样式_javascript技巧【图】

摘要:我们在开发过程中经常会遇到通过js获取或者改变DOM元素的样式,方法有很多,比如:通过更改DOM元素的class。现在我们讨论原生js来获取DOM元素的CSS样式,注意是获取不是设置在开始之前先说下获取最终应用在元素上的所有CSS属性对象的意思是,如果没有给元素设置任何样式,也会把浏览器默认的样式返回来。 1、ele.style在学习DOM的时候就看到通过ele.style来获取元素样式值,但是有时候获取的并非是节点的样式值,而是空值。这...

javascript获取当前鼠标坐标的方法_javascript技巧【图】

本文实例讲述了javascript获取当前鼠标坐标的方法。分享给大家供大家参考。具体实现方法如下: 对于javascript获取当前鼠标坐标来说,得对不同浏览器的坐标位置有所了解。具体代码如下:代码如下:javascript获取当前鼠标坐标function mousePosition(ev){if(ev.pageX || ev.pageY){//firefox、chrome等浏览器return {x:ev.pageX,y:ev.pageY};}return {// IE浏览器x:ev.clientX + document.body.scrollLeft - document.body.clientLe...

javascript获取四位数字或者字母的随机数_javascript技巧【图】

本章节通过代码实例介绍一下如何实现简单的四位随机数功能。 比较简单的一种实现方式就是从数字和字母中随机抽取四个不重复的字符。 代码实例如下:function only(ele,arr){ if(arr.length==0){ return true; } for(var j=0;j上面的代码实现了我们的要求,下面就介绍一下上面代码的实现过程。一.代码注释: 1.function only(ele,arr){},此函数可以实现判断指定的索引是否已经使用过了,放置随机数出现重复。 2.if(arr.length==0){},...

javascript获取浏览器版本_基础知识

工作中需要通过JS去获取当前使用的浏览器的名字以及版本号,网上大堆资料都有一个关键词是 navigator.appName,但是这个方法获取的浏览器的名字只有两种要么是IE要么就是Netscap,倒是可以用来判断是否使用了IE,但是我想获取具体的浏览器产品名字比如 Firefox,Chrome等。代码如下: function BroswerUtil() { } BroswerUtil.prototype = {getBrowserVersion: function () {var agent = navigator.userAgent.toLowerCase();var ar...

javascript获取元素离文档各边距离的方法_javascript技巧

本文实例讲述了javascript获取元素离文档各边距离的方法。分享给大家供大家参考。具体实现方法如下:代码如下:function getDistance(obj) { if (!obj instanceof jQuery) { obj = $(obj); } var distance = {}; distance.top = (obj.offset().top - $(document).scrollTop()); distance.bottom = ($(window).height() - distance.top - obj.outerHeight()); distance.left = (obj.offset().left - $(document).scrollLeft()...

JAVASCRIPT - 技术教程分类
JavaScript 教程 JavaScript 简介 JavaScript 用法 JavaScript Chrome 中运行 JavaScript 输出 JavaScript 语法 JavaScript 语句 JavaScript 注释 JavaScript 变量 JavaScript 数据类型 JavaScript 对象 JavaScript 函数 JavaScript 作用域 JavaScript 事件 JavaScript 字符串 JavaScript 运算符 JavaScript 比较 JavaScript 条件语句 JavaScript switch 语句 JavaScript for 循环 JavaScript while 循环 JavaScript break 和 continue 语... JavaScript typeof JavaScript 类型转换 JavaScript 正则表达式 JavaScript 错误 JavaScript 调试 JavaScript 变量提升 JavaScript 严格模式 JavaScript 使用误区 JavaScript 表单 JavaScript 表单验证 JavaScript 验证 API JavaScript 保留关键字 JavaScript this JavaScript let 和 const JavaScript JSON JavaScript void JavaScript 异步编程 JavaScript Promise JavaScript 代码规范 JavaScript 函数定义 JavaScript 函数参数 JavaScript 函数调用 JavaScript 闭包 DOM 简介 DOM HTML DOM CSS DOM 事件 DOM EventListener DOM 元素 HTMLCollection 对象 NodeList 对象 JavaScript 对象 JavaScript prototype JavaScript Number 对象 JavaScript String JavaScript Date(日期) JavaScript Array(数组) JavaScript Boolean(布尔) JavaScript Math(算数) JavaScript RegExp 对象 JavaScript Window JavaScript Window Location JavaScript Navigator JavaScript 弹窗 JavaScript 计时事件 JavaScript Cookie JavaScript 库 JavaScript 实例 JavaScript 对象实例 JavaScript 浏览器对象实例 JavaScript HTML DOM 实例 JavaScript 总结 JavaScript 对象 HTML DOM 对象 JavaScript 异步编程 javascript 全部